Baraha

Baraha is a village located in Raghurajnagar tehsil of Satna district in Madhya Pradesh, India. It is situated 25km away from Satna, which is both district & sub-district headquarter of Baraha village. As per 2009 stats, Baraha village is also a gram panchayat.

About Baraha

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Baraha is 462993. The village spans a total geographical area of 31.82 hectares. Satna is nearest town to Baraha village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 25km away.

Population of Baraha

Below is a concise population overview of Baraha as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 18 7 11
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 4 1 3
Scheduled Castes (SC) 1 1 N/A
Scheduled Tribes (ST) N/A N/A N/A
Literate Population 13 5 8
Illiterate Population 5 2 3

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Baraha village:

  • The total population of Baraha village is around 18, including approximately 7 males and 11 females, with a sex ratio of 1571 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 4 children aged 0–6 years in Baraha village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Baraha village has 1 person bel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
  • The literacy rate of Baraha village is about 72.22%, with male literacy at 71.43% and female literacy at 72.73%.
  • There are around 4 households in Baraha village.

Connectivity of Baraha

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Baraha. As per the 2011 stats, Baraha had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Private Bus Service Available within 10+ km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
